
China's Public Security Minister Guo Shengkun met with Serbian Interior Minister Nebojsa Stefanovic on Monday, pledging to enhance law enforcement cooperation.
Both sides should enhance cooperation in anti-terrorism, drug control, fighting cybercrime and law enforcement capacity building to foster a secure and stable environment for the Belt and Road Initiative and cooperation between China and Central and Eastern Europe, said Guo, who is also State Councilor.
Stefanovic said Serbia is willing to deepen law enforcement cooperation with China and advance relations with China to a new level.
